Clearing bad UEFI variable
Hello,
I have a E6420 laptop that has a bad value written to an EFI variable. Specifically, the data in Boot0007 is somehow not good. As a result when I attempt to boot the machine, it goes through the POST, the POST screen is cleared with a black screen but then halts. I assume the firmware is attempting to parse that bad value and fails.
During the POST, you can select F12 for one-time boot, the text appears in the upper right but same result (black screen). Same thing with F2, Del, etc.
I've already tried pulling the CMOS battery, which didn't work. I didn't expect it to but had to try.
Is there a way to clear out this bad variable from UEFI? This is a test machine so wiping everything is fine. Once I get it to boot anything again, even another UEFI application, I'll be all set.
